Youth Football - Practice #7 of the 2008 SeasonPosted by: Mr.Football in Football Sites and The Best ArticlesAfter the usual dynamic warm up and angle fit and form tackling, we got right into individual defensive drills. We started off with a game of tackle baseball, a game the kids and parents love. It also gives us a nice picture of who can tackle in the “somewhat” open field. The Defensive Ends: Worked on base sweep recognition and footwork maintaining the proper depth and outside leverage. They then worked on using their hands to keep reach and lead blockers at bay. The Defensive Backs: Worked on base footwork, maintaining the proper cushion with the receiver and closing on the ball. They also worked on open field tackling. The Defensive tackles worked on their base bull rush and rip moves, adding a form tackle fit later in the progression. They then moved to close quarters tackling drills. The Bearcrawlers: Did our usual progression, relay race, squeeze, squeeze to form tackle fit and squeeze to pass recognition. Big Fall For Wisconsin Badgers FootballPosted by: Mr.Football in Football Sites and The Best ArticlesNow they are 1-5 in conference and at the bottom of the Big Ten teams. That is one of the biggest drops I’ve ever seen for almost any team. It compares to the Michigan Wolverines dropping out of the rankings last year after losing to Appalachian State. Michigan had been ranked fifth in the preseason. Both are remarkable drops. Most projections had Wisconsin at second right behind Ohio State for the final Big Ten standings at the end of the year. The Badgers still have games at Indiana and against a good rival Minnesota. They also play Cal Poly, but that should be an easy win. The Badgers are unlikely to qualify for a bowl game unless they win out and some strange bowl committee feels sorry for them. Wisconsin has had a good football program the last few year and usually been in the top 5 teams in the conference. To the Badgers credit they have had a lot of close losses to good teams this year. They narrowly were defeated by a measly two points to Michigan. AC Milan Shirt to Be Beckham’s Last?Posted by: Mr.Football in Football Sites and The Best ArticlesDavid Beckham is never far from the limelight, he is a model professional with a driven desire to be the best footballer he can be. That much shows from his determination to become England’s most capped outfield player hopefully surpassing that of former legend and World Cup winner Sir Bobby Moore. It looked like it was going to be the end for the man they call Golden Balls when he was surprisingly dropped by Steve McLaren upon becoming England manager. It was the sign of things and changes to come for the three lions. With young emerging talent on the wing in the likes of David Bentley, Aaron Lennon, Theo Walcott and Ashley Young it seemed the legs of Beckham were set for retirement. After he stepped down as England captain many thought they would never see him in an England shirt again, but he changed all that. Some fans called for him to be selected again as many forwards were missing those pinpoint crosses and fans were missing those trademark free kicks.
